Web15 iun. 2015 · Here’s how it happens: Your jaw muscles tighten when you grind or clench your teeth – or do things such as chew gum. The pain from your jaw created by the clenching then travels to other places in the skull, causing headaches or, in severe cases, migraines. You may also experience toothaches, earaches or shoulder pain.

Squamous cells make up the mucosa layer (the outermost lining) of tissue on the inside of the mouth, including … Web2 aug. 2024 · A small disc in the joint allows the bones of your jaw to slip and slide normally. With TMJ, the disc becomes displaced, leading to clicking, snapping, and limited jaw movement. It can also cause pain in your jaw and face, and the muscles around your jaw may become sore or go into spasm. Web9 iun. 2024 ·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) Disorder. The most common signs and symptoms of TMJ disorder include jaw tenderness that may feel like a toothache, as well as a headache or earache. 1. The pain may worsen when chewing food, and you may hear and/or feel a clicking or popping noise when eating.
